Make my best sweet stout!
The article is from : https://beerandbrewing.com/make-your-best-sweet-milk-stout/
grist :
4.8kg of Maris Otter
454g of pale chocolate malt(215L)
227g of Dehusked Carafa 3
227g of lactose
hops :
2 ounces(57g) of Fuggles at 20min
Ringwood yeast(Wyeast #1187)
When to add the lactose?
Flame-out of about five minutes left in the boil
(Stir in the lactose until dissolved, and then finish off the boil and chill as usual)
Key step :
Ferment cooler than usual for English ales(15 degrees celsius is a great starting point)
(OMG. It's not gonna be good until the next fall. It already hit up to over 20 degrees celsius in daytimes now.)
Carbonate? about 1.75 volumes.
(Cause slightly lower carbonation level will add an impression of sweetness)
